发明名称 VECTOR MASK REGISTER MANAGING SYSTEM
摘要 PURPOSE:To increase a program executing speed by constituting a titled system so that an instruction for shunting and recovering a vector mask register is not generated, in case when the vector mask register which is used by an object program and a built-in procedure is not overlapped. CONSTITUTION:A comparing part 25 retrieves a built-in procedure vector mask register table 24 and fetches an address of a vector mask register required by a quoted built-in procedure, and compares it with an address of the vector mask register which must save the contents at the time of a quotation of the built-in procedure, based on an execution time vector mask register use state record 23. An object code generating part 26 generates an instruction for shunting the contents of the vector mask register immediately before an instruction 32 for calling the built-in procedure, only in case when it is necessary to shunt the contents of the vector mask register, based on a notice from the comparing part 25, and also generated an instruction for recovering the contents of the vector mask register which has been shunted immediately after the instruction train 32.
申请公布号 JPS61204770(A) 申请公布日期 1986.09.10
申请号 JP19850045914 申请日期 1985.03.08
申请人 NEC CORP 发明人 NEMOTO RYOJI
分类号 G06F9/45;G06F9/38;G06F15/78;G06F17/16 主分类号 G06F9/45
代理机构 代理人
主权项
地址